By a News Reporter-Staff News Editor at Robotics & Machine Learning Daily News Daily News – Data detailed on Machine Learning have been presented. According to news reporting from Guangzhou, People’s Republic of China, by NewsRx journalists, research stated, “Diesel reforming is a promisinghydrogen production technology used for the clean energy conversion of high-ca rbon-content fuels. Although the reaction system has been established, predicting the optimal reaction conditions for the system remains challenging.”
